Start your Neapolitan adventure with a visit to Castel dell'Ovo, one of the city's oldest fortresses, located on the seafront. After exploring the castle, enjoy lunch at one of the restaurants overlooking the sea, where you can savor the delights of local cuisine with breathtaking views of the Gulf of Naples. Continue towards Piazza del Plebiscito, one of the largest and most majestic squares in Italy, dominated by the Basilica of San Francesco di Paola and the Royal Palace. From here, stroll along Via Toledo, one of the main shopping streets. Don't miss the Galleria Umberto I, a magnificent example of 19th century architecture with its glass and iron roof. Finally, stop to admire from the outside the Maschio Angioino, an imposing medieval castle that bears witness to the thousand-year history of Naples.
In the heart of the historic center of Naples, the Sansevero Chapel is a jewel of the Baroque full of symbolism, art and mystery. Wanted by Prince Raymond of Sangro, it houses the famous Veiled Christ, the extraordinary marble sculpture by Giuseppe Sanmartino, famous for the transparent veil carved in stone with incredible realism. The chapel also houses other enigmatic works, including the Anatomical Machines, making it one of the most fascinating and mysterious places in the city.
